We are really glad to start this updating report with great news: our Country Manager and Aleimar’s Volunteer Gaetano Fiorella has finally come back to Palestine this January for the periodic monitoring trip! This has been the opportunity to visit all the projects and local partners with which Aleimar has been collaborating for years. Our Country Manager has undertaken this trip together with our Aleimar’s volunteers Angela, Attilio and Ugo. They have arrived to Bethlehem and have started this unique experience.
They have visited all the children supported in Bethlehem Ephpheta Institute, where students with hearing disabilities receive specialized educational and tailored scholastic paths. All the children are in good health and they are showing great improvements!
Thanks to the Institute, they also take part in different and very motivating activities. For example, in September they have participated in the olive harvest in the Open School Paolo VI and in October two Pedagogical experts from Italy have worked on the development of the skills and attitudes of the students.
